If you’re working in the Microsoft ecosystem, MSG files are handy, but they are notoriously hard to open, search or share outside that ecosystem. Transitioning to PDF serves as an ideal strategy for sustainable long-term archiving, meeting regulatory compliance requirements, or ensuring your documents remain easily accessible across non-Windows platforms. The trick is to perform this conversion without stripping away any of the original email’s attachments, formatting or metadata.

The software’s main strength is for batch operations. The program can pick out individual files or entire folders, whether you’re working with a handful of emails or a huge archive.
One of the big benefits is that it’s not tied to the Microsoft suite. This utility is a standalone application, unlike many other tools, and does not need an active Outlook installation to convert. This is a huge advantage for users who are decommissioning old workstations, or no longer have access to an active Outlook license.
